Originally Posted by karlfranz
Do you have any in-process pictures? Also, what items did you remove during the process: headlamps, taillights, side-markers, grille, strakes, meshes, badges, helicopter tape? Still trying to figure out how to wrap the door handles. That's the one thing keeping me from tackling this project myself.

Also, just noticed you wrapped the headlamp washers. Never seen that done before. Neat.
We currently don't have any pictures of the removal process. We had removed the fender and hood vents, Front Bumper , Rear bumper, Taillights, Fender liners,
Mirrors, and all the badges, To get to the mirror you will need to remove the door panels.

Their shouldn't be any type of negative effects on the original finish unless the vinyl is not properly taken car of. Life span should last from 3-5 years if properly taken car of.

Originally Posted by 07sportspack
Impressive.......very impressive indeed. How long before it must be removed in order not to have a negative effect on the original finish? Nice job!!!
